Lancaster win 5-4 in Men's 2nd Tennis

1 min read

Jeremy Cain won a thrilling final set 6-4 in his singles match against Matt Holland to give Lancaster the win in the Men’s 2nds Tennis. After taking the first set 6-3 Cain dropped the second, but was able to put in a heroic performance in the rain to take the decider 6 – 4.
